Title: | Black Glaze Pyxis | |
Category: | Pottery | |
Description: | Half preserved. Flat bottom and very slightly concave side wall, tipped a little inwards. Plain concave moulding around bottom. Flange on inner side of rim to receive lid. Good black glaze, slightly peeled, inside and out. The bottom, and the rim save for the inner edge, reserved. | |
Context: | Pit, second half of 5th. c. | |
